CVE-2013-10050
C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N
Summary
An OS command injection vulnerability exists in multiple D-Link routers (confirmed on DIR-300 rev A v1.05 and DIR-615 rev D v4.13) via the authenticated tools_vct.xgi CGI endpoint. The web interface fails to properly sanitize user-supplied input in the pingIp parameter, allowing attackers with valid credentials to inject arbitrary shell commands. Exploitation enables full device compromise, including spawning a telnet daemon and establishing a root shell. The vulnerability is present in firmware versions that expose tools_vct.xgi and use the Mathopd/1.5p6 web server. No vendor patch is available, and affected models are end-of-life.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| D-Link | DIR-300 rev A | 0 <= 1.05 | affected |
| D-Link | DIR-615 rev D | 0 <= 4.13 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-78: CWE-78 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an OS Command ('OS Command Injection')
